Question to the Department of Health and Social Care:

To ask the Secretary of State for Health and Social Care, what steps he is taking to support couples access IVF treatment.


Answered by
Maria Caulfield Portrait
Maria Caulfield
This question was answered on 23rd June 2023

The Women’s Health Strategy was published on 20 July 2022 and contained a number of important changes and future ambitions to improve the variations in access to National Health Service funded fertility services.

We will improve access to in vitro fertilisation (IVF) by removing the additional financial burden on female same-sex couples accessing treatment. We will be working with NHS England to assess fertility provision across integrated care boards, which have responsibility for commissioning fertility services, with a view to removing non-clinical access criteria. We will also work with stakeholders to improve information provision on fertility and fertility treatments, including on the NHS website, and introduce greater transparency of the local provision of IVF.
